From b3b0fd266bbed6b1a5a12a0825c53d1aa9f02755 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Gutyina=20Gerg=C5=91?= Date: Tue, 27 May 2025 22:26:16 +0200 Subject: [PATCH] lib: prefer replaceString over replaceStrings --- lib/gvariant.nix | 4 ++-- lib/strings.nix | 2 +- lib/systems/default.nix | 4 ++--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/lib/gvariant.nix b/lib/gvariant.nix index d316a3254a25..e66217db8188 100644 --- a/lib/gvariant.nix +++ b/lib/gvariant.nix @@ -18,7 +18,7 @@ let concatStrings escape head - replaceStrings + replaceString ; mkPrimitive = t: v: { @@ -451,7 +451,7 @@ rec { mkString = v: let - sanitize = s: replaceStrings [ "\n" ] [ "\\n" ] (escape [ "'" "\\" ] s); + sanitize = s: replaceString "\n" "\\n" (escape [ "'" "\\" ] s); in mkPrimitive type.string v // { diff --git a/lib/strings.nix b/lib/strings.nix index ca97e5b4658b..359e1a4cd8db 100644 --- a/lib/strings.nix +++ b/lib/strings.nix @@ -1173,7 +1173,7 @@ rec { string = toString arg; in if match "[[:alnum:],._+:@%/-]+" string == null then - "'${replaceStrings [ "'" ] [ "'\\''" ] string}'" + "'${replaceString "'" "'\\''" string}'" else string; diff --git a/lib/systems/default.nix b/lib/systems/default.nix index 4d4a6d0030a6..6b9da270bf5f 100644 --- a/lib/systems/default.nix +++ b/lib/systems/default.nix @@ -14,7 +14,7 @@ let optionalAttrs optionalString removeSuffix - replaceStrings + replaceString toUpper ; @@ -522,7 +522,7 @@ let # # https://github.com/rust-lang/cargo/pull/9169 # https://github.com/rust-lang/cargo/issues/8285#issuecomment-634202431 - cargoEnvVarTarget = replaceStrings [ "-" ] [ "_" ] (toUpper final.rust.cargoShortTarget); + cargoEnvVarTarget = replaceString "-" "_" (toUpper final.rust.cargoShortTarget); # True if the target is no_std # https://github.com/rust-lang/rust/blob/2e44c17c12cec45b6a682b1e53a04ac5b5fcc9d2/src/bootstrap/config.rs#L415-L421